Commonwealth National Climate Finance Adviser – Mauritius

148

This Project will provide assistance to Mauritius to increase access to Climate Finance at the national level through the development of a pipeline of project proposals targeting relevant climate finance funding envelopes and supported by improved cross-ministerial coordination of efforts to operationalise the national climate change frameworks.

This support is delivered under the Commonwealth Climate Finance Access Hub which deploys long-term technical experts to help small and other vulnerable Commonwealth member countries to access international climate finance to support their climate mitigation, adaptation and resilience efforts, as well as build human and institutional capacity to take forward climate action. 

The role of the National Climate Finance Adviser is to strengthen institutional and individual capacity; and increase access to climate finance to implement climate adaptation and mitigation projects, leading to enhanced understanding of climate impacts and financing needs and enhanced ability to develop, manage and fund climate activities and programmes.
